On this safari you sleep in the Tundra Buggy Lodge, surrounded by bears. The lodge is a specially-built huddle of Buggies, made very warm and comfortable. On the lodge you have more time to see the bears' social and family life. But walking outside is not recommended! Awww... So cuddly! But just look at those claws… You also get more of an immersion into the fascinating human life in the Arctic.

Stay outside the town of Churchill at the Tundra Buggy Lodge, where you are around the polar bears day and night. With a slightly larger group, a multi-talented staff member acts as your Buggy driver and host at the Tundra Buggy Lodge.

Although you are visiting the area primarily for a Churchill polar bear tour, there are other attractions too— the historic gun batteries of Cape Merry, the Port of Churchill, which is Canada’s only Arctic grain terminal, and the wrecked hull of the ore ship “Ithaca.” In town, visit Parks Canada’s displays of Churchill’s early days. The Eskimo Museum is a wonderful place, renowned for its outstanding collection of historic and contemporary Inuit artwork. You will also find a wide variety of art to look at or buy—including Inuit carvings, paintings, prints, moose hair tufting, and other items with a distinctive northern flavour.
